Freezer Material Handler Lead - 3rd Shift
Location : Holland, MI
Reports To : Warehouse Floor Supervisor
Position Summary
This role combines hands-on work with leadership responsibilities, guiding the team and actively participating in warehouse and freezer operations to meet production, quality, safety, and maintenance standards. The lead coordinates daily activities to ensure operational efficiency, cost control, and compliance, while providing support, resolving issues, and fostering a positive, high-performing team culture.
Duties & Responsibilities
- Provide mentorship and daily servant leadership to guide, support, and empower the team while optimizing resource use
- Serve as the shift’s front-line leader, guiding the team, managing daily workflow expectations, and actively participating in freezer material handling tasks
- Partner with Warehouse Leadership to develop, track, and communicate KPI’s educate the team, and hold team members accountable to drive performance
- Maintain a clean, safe, and organized work environment; ensure equipment and facilities are properly maintained, including daily safety checks
- Offer ongoing feedback on team performance, partnering with leadership on formal and informal performance discussions
- Support team growth through coaching, mentoring, and hands-on training
- Uphold all safety standards, operational SOPs, and GMP requirements on the production floor
